Barrel Aged Liquor Investments: A Refined Choice
For the discerning investor, cask whisky investments present a attractive alternative to standard financial instruments. The allure of owning a physical asset with inherent value, coupled with the potential for significant returns, makes this an increasingly popular option. Whisky aficionados can benefit from their passion while diversifying their portfolios with a luxury asset class that historically appreciates over time.
- Factors driving this trend include global demand for premium spirits, limited production runs of rare whiskies, and the proven track record of cask whisky as a store of value.
- The process of investing in cask whisky typically involves acquiring a share of a maturing cask from a reputable distillery or broker.
- Investors can then monitor the cask's development and ultimately reap the rewards upon its eventual bottling and sale.
Investing in cask whisky requires thorough research to guarantee authenticity, provenance, and potential returns.
